Question
Isabella has 2 containers. Container S and Container T are of different capacities. If Container S is filled by a tap at a rate of 3 litres per minute and Container T is filled by a tap at a rate of 7 litres per minute, when Container S is completely filled, 8 litres of water flowed out from Container T. If Container S is filled by a tap at a rate of 6 litres per minute and Container T is filled by a tap at a rate of 3 litres per minute, when Container S is completely filled, Container T is only half-filled. What is the capacity of Container T? Express your answer in litres.
